Chiropractic is a regulated, primary-contact health care profession, using a variety of non-invasive, hands-on manual therapies and modalities for treatment of the neuromusculoskeletal system.

Acupuncture:
Acupuncture is a safe, non-invasive therapy used to promote natural healing and reduce pain. An ancient form of Chinese medicine, acupuncture has provided effective relief for centuries. Acupuncture treatment involves inserting a series of specially designed needles into the skin at specific points in the body. Acupuncture needles are very fine, flexible and slide smoothly through tissue so they do not cause bleeding or tissue damage. There is no drug injected through the needles; the presence of the needles themselves provides stimulation that achieves the beneficial effects of acupuncture treatment. Needles are typically left in place for 10 to 20 minutes.
Acupuncture has been know to provide effective, natural treatment for many conditions.
